Home
last modified time | relevance | path

Searched refs:count_hz (Results 1 – 4 of 4) sorted by relevance

/Linux-v5.10/arch/mips/kvm/
Demulate.c353 return div_u64(delta * vcpu->arch.count_hz, NSEC_PER_SEC); in kvm_mips_ktime_to_count()
512 delta = div_u64(delta * NSEC_PER_SEC, vcpu->arch.count_hz); in kvm_mips_resume_hrtimer()
587 delta = div_u64(delta * NSEC_PER_SEC, vcpu->arch.count_hz); in kvm_mips_restore_hrtimer()
628 void kvm_mips_init_count(struct kvm_vcpu *vcpu, unsigned long count_hz) in kvm_mips_init_count() argument
630 vcpu->arch.count_hz = count_hz; in kvm_mips_init_count()
631 vcpu->arch.count_period = div_u64((u64)NSEC_PER_SEC << 32, count_hz); in kvm_mips_init_count()
649 int kvm_mips_set_count_hz(struct kvm_vcpu *vcpu, s64 count_hz) in kvm_mips_set_count_hz() argument
657 if (count_hz <= 0 || count_hz > NSEC_PER_SEC) in kvm_mips_set_count_hz()
660 if (vcpu->arch.count_hz == count_hz) in kvm_mips_set_count_hz()
673 vcpu->arch.count_hz = count_hz; in kvm_mips_set_count_hz()
[all …]
Dvz.c347 if (mips_hpt_frequency != vcpu->arch.count_hz) in kvm_vz_should_use_htimer()
2122 *v = vcpu->arch.count_hz; in kvm_vz_get_one_reg()
3076 unsigned long count_hz = 100*1000*1000; /* default to 100 MHz */ in kvm_vz_vcpu_setup() local
3083 count_hz = mips_hpt_frequency; in kvm_vz_vcpu_setup()
3084 kvm_mips_init_count(vcpu, count_hz); in kvm_vz_vcpu_setup()
Dtrap_emul.c846 *v = vcpu->arch.count_hz; in kvm_trap_emul_get_one_reg()
/Linux-v5.10/arch/mips/include/asm/
Dkvm_host.h388 u32 count_hz; member
1077 void kvm_mips_init_count(struct kvm_vcpu *vcpu, unsigned long count_hz);
1080 int kvm_mips_set_count_hz(struct kvm_vcpu *vcpu, s64 count_hz);